Heim  >  Artikel  >  Web-Frontend  >  Verwenden Sie CSS, um den aktuellen Kanal in der Navigationsleiste zu markieren

Verwenden Sie CSS, um den aktuellen Kanal in der Navigationsleiste zu markieren

不言
不言Original
2018-07-02 09:52:551745Durchsuche

In diesem Artikel wird hauptsächlich die Verwendung von CSS zum Markieren des aktuellen Kanals in der Navigationsleiste vorgestellt. Jetzt kann ich ihn mit Ihnen teilen.

Einführung in Webjx-Artikel zur Webseitenproduktion: Die Technologie zur Verwendung von CSS zum Markieren des aktuellen Kanals in der Navigationsleiste gibt es schon seit langem. Sie wurde in vielen CSS-Büchern eingeführt, wird aber immer noch gefragt, deshalb habe ich einen einfachen Artikel geschrieben Beispiel, um es zu erklären.

Tatsächlich ist das Prinzip sehr einfach:
1) Definieren Sie entsprechend den verschiedenen Kanälen (Spalten) jeweils IDs für den Körper. Zum Beispiel:
Startseite:
Blog-Kanal:
Album-Kanal: Alle Seiten im Kanal müssen einheitlich definierte IDs haben.
2) Die entsprechende Spalte der Navigationsleiste definiert auch die ID oder Klasse:

<ul id="nav">
<li class="nav_home"><a href="index.html">首页</a></li>
<li class="nav_blog"><a href="blog.html">Blog</a></li>
<li class="nav_album"><a href="album.html">相册</a></li>
</ul></p>
<p style="text-align: left;">3) Die aktuelle Position wird durch verschiedene Körper-IDs unterschieden: </p>
<pre class="brush:php;toolbar:false">#p_home .nav_home a,
#p_blog .nav_blog a,
#p_album .nav_album a {
……
}

Das Obige ist der gesamte Inhalt Ich hoffe, dass dieser Artikel für das Lernen aller hilfreich ist. Weitere verwandte Inhalte finden Sie auf der chinesischen PHP-Website!

Verwandte Empfehlungen:

Einführung in die CSS3-Nahaufnahmekompatibilität des jQuery-Browsers

Das obige ist der detaillierte Inhalt vonVerwenden Sie CSS, um den aktuellen Kanal in der Navigationsleiste zu markieren.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n